Berlin, July 16, 2026: Native Instruments has today launched SuperStarSaw, a synthesizer co-created with GRAMMY-winning A. G. Cook, British producer, PC Music founder, and one of the key architects of contemporary pop's defining sonic palette.
Supersaws, multiple sawtooth waves layered and slightly detuned against each other, are responsible for some of modern pop's most immediately recognisable textures: the wide, lush, harmonically dense quality running through Cook's work with Charli xcx, Beyoncรฉ, Caroline Polachek, and Oklou. Building them has always meant painstaking multi-instance layering, a process Cook had refined over years of his own production work, and which became the starting point for what followed. The instrument grew out of a two-year collaboration with Native Instruments' design team, who worked directly from Cook's patches and production sessions to turn one of modern pop's most coveted sounds into something you can actually play.
